Yellow skin: Most common cause of jaundice is physiologic , which usually causes yellowish discoloration of skin and eyes and usually mild. Newborn jaundice caused due to reasons like blood type mismatch between mother and baby, congenital abnormalities of liver or biliary tract, congenital or acquired infections in newborn or bleeding beneath scalp can also poor feeding , tiredness and lead to kernicterus.

A few: Jaundice cause a yellow discoloration to skin and conjunctiva. It can cause irritablity, lethargy and poor feeding. In the severe cases, when the bilirubin crosses the blood/brain barrier, it can cause permanent neurological insult.
